Sultanpur National Park is located at Sultanpur village on Gurugram-Jhajjar highway, 15 km from Gurugram, Haryana and 50 km from Delhi in India. This covers approximately 142.52 hectares.

Sultanpur Bird Sanctuary, a haven for nature enthusiasts, is a hidden gem located just outside of Gurgaon. This sanctuary offers a unique opportunity to witness a diverse array of avian wonders. Birdwatching Paradise The sanctuary is particularly renowned for its migratory bird population. During the winter months, the skies come alive with a kaleidoscope of colors as thousands of birds flock to this serene wetland. From the majestic pelicans to the elusive Siberian cranes, birdwatchers can delight in spotting a variety of species. The park's diverse ecosystem, comprising lakes, grasslands, and woodlands, provides an ideal habitat for these feathered visitors. Antelopes and More In addition to its avian treasures, Sultanpur Bird Sanctuary is also home to several species of antelopes. The graceful blackbuck, with its distinctive spiral horns, is a common sight in the open grasslands. Visitors may also encounter the nimble chinkara, a small antelope with a striking coat. A Peaceful Retreat The sanctuary offers a tranquil escape from the hustle and bustle of city life. The well-maintained trails wind through the park, providing ample opportunities for leisurely walks and nature photography. The serene ambiance, coupled with the soothing sounds of chirping birds, creates a truly rejuvenating experience. A Few Shortcomings While the sanctuary offers a delightful experience, there are a few areas that could be improved. The cleanliness of the washrooms leaves much to be desired, and visitors may find the lack of adequate signage somewhat inconvenient. However, these minor issues do not detract significantly from the overall appeal of the park. Ticket Prices and Timings The ticket prices for entry to the sanctuary are quite affordable, making it accessible to visitors of all budgets. The park is open throughout the year, with varying timings depending on the season. It is advisable to check the official website for the latest information on timings and entry fees. In conclusion, Sultanpur Bird Sanctuary is a must-visit destination for nature lovers and birdwatchers. Its diverse ecosystem, coupled with the opportunity to witness a wide range of avian species, makes it a truly unforgettable experience. Sultanpur National Park (सुल्तानपुर नेशनल पार्क) is a popular bird sanctuary located in Gurgaon district, Haryana, India. Here are some key features of Sultanpur National Park:

Bird Sanctuary: Sultanpur National Park is renowned for its birdlife, especially during the winter months when migratory birds visit the park. It provides a habitat for a variety of resident and migratory bird species.

Migratory Birds: The park attracts a large number of migratory birds, including various species of ducks, geese, and waders. Birds from regions like Siberia, Europe, and Central Asia visit the park during the winter season.

Lake and Wetlands: The park has a network of wetlands and a central lake, providing suitable conditions for aquatic birds. Birdwatchers and nature enthusiasts visit the park to observe and study the diverse avian population.

Flora and Fauna: Apart from birds, Sultanpur National Park is home to a variety of flora and fauna. The park features grasslands, woodlands, and water bodies, creating a diverse ecosystem.

Visitor Facilities: The park offers facilities for visitors, including birdwatching points, nature trails, and watchtowers. There's also an education and interpretation centre providing information about avian species and the importance of conservation.

Conservation Efforts: Sultanpur National Park plays a crucial role in bird conservation and habitat preservation. The park's wetlands are essential for the migratory birds seeking refuge during the winter.

Located just 15km from Gurgaon, Sultanpur National Park, formerly known as Sultanpur Bird Sanctuary, is a hidden gem for nature enthusiasts. While Gurgaon bustles with activity, the park offers a tranquil escape, perfect for a day trip. The park's main attraction is undoubtedly its diverse birdlife. With 250+ species recorded, including ~90 migratory birds, Sultanpur is a paradise for birdwatchers. During the winter months (Sep to Mar), the park comes alive with a symphony of colors and calls as migratory birds arrive from Siberia, Central Asia, and Europe. The park has four watchtowers (machans) along with a hut strategically placed for clear views of the lake. Whether you're a seasoned birder with a hefty checklist or a curious nature lover, Sultanpur offers a delightful opportunity to witness a variety of avian wonders. Apart from birdwatching, the park's walking trails offer a chance to immerse yourself in nature. The lush greenery with trees, shrubs, and bougainvillea creates a picturesque backdrop for a leisurely stroll. The park also provides basic amenities like restrooms, drinking water (only at entrance) and a parking area. Birdwatching Essentials: A good pair of binoculars or a zoom lens camera is a must to get a good look at the birds. The Best Time to Visit: Winter is the prime season for spotting migratory birds. Timings: The park is open from 7:00 AM to 4:30 PM. While the park could benefit from some improvements in maintenance, the beauty of nature and the chance to witness diverse birdlife make it a worthwhile visit
